# How to save tax?

Tax is a mandatory contribution levied on individuals or organizations by the government. Taxes are imposed by the government to help fund public works and services and for the betterment of the country. The revenue collected by the government in the form of tax is being used to build and maintain infrastructure, help in public works and services, maintain the economy, and finance government works and services in the country. Taxes play an important role in maintaining and improving the country's economy. The revenue collected through taxes plays a vital role in the smooth functioning of the country. Whether you are a [business owner](https://yourviews.mindstick.com/view/85986/10-tips-to-become-a-successful-business-owner), a salaried public or private employee, a freelancer, or an investor, you have to pay tax to the government as per the Income Tax Act 1961. The rates of taxes may vary for different age groups. All individuals, residents or non-residents, need to pay taxes to the government based on their taxable income per year.

Here are some tax-saving investments in which you can invest your money and save your tax:

Public Provident Fund (PPF) [Section 80C]\
National savings certificate\
Sukanya samridhi\
Fixed Deposit\
Equity-linked savings scheme\
Life [insurance policy](https://www.mindstick.com/articles/23230/a-summary-of-the-maruti-suzuki-insurance-policy)\
Home loan principal amount\
National Pension Scheme [Section 80CCD]\
Post office schemes\
House rent allowance [Section 10(13A)]

Apart from the investments mentioned above, there are other ways to save tax, such as interest income on your [savings account](https://answers.mindstick.com/qa/98348/how-do-i-transfer-my-sbi-savings-account-to-another-sbi-branch), interest received from an NRE account, amounts received from equity shares or mutual funds, investments in medical [insurance premiums](https://answers.mindstick.com/qa/107292/how-does-my-health-affect-life-insurance-premiums) for yourself, and many other such plans. There are also some legal sections under which you can save tax; many of the investments mentioned above also fall under these sections: 80C, 80CCD, 80CCC, 80D, 80CCG, 80D, 80DD, 80DDB, 80E, 80EEB, 80G, 54, 54F.
